Output 011d31190eaeb71c63705ebfe3543a6f427b749ca69054356c9c421722a78a30:2

value
37050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054a19e6336c46169ec3fc8a9ab0448372de04ae OP_EQUAL
address
32Az59DDPVdfssoPZEbbhkgeYjDUax4vwJ
transaction
011d31190eaeb71c63705ebfe3543a6f427b749ca69054356c9c421722a78a30
spent
true